Transaction 150529e632bf2020422a9c0271d223a4cb7d78496e56445a0cf93dc36f1942de
1 Input
1 Output
-
150529e632bf2020422a9c0271d223a4cb7d78496e56445a0cf93dc36f1942de:0
- value
- 577722
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 174c8408549b67cfe0e37410c2d3adf3949b6119 OP_EQUAL
- address
- 33pD8N37SXp4MrLzsRsY7UzvCKh1wWUx1U